What Is Food Encapsulation?
Food encapsulation refers to the technology of entrapping active ingredients, such as nutrients, flavors, enzymes, probiotics, lipids, and bioactive compounds, within a protective material to ensure stability, controlled release, and targeted delivery. This protective barrier—created through methods such as spray drying, coacervation, liposomal encapsulation, nano-encapsulation, and extrusion—helps prevent degradation caused by oxygen, moisture, light, heat, or interactions with other food components. In 2025, encapsulation technologies accounted for a crucial value-added function in functional foods, fortified beverages, dietary supplements, bakery, dairy, and plant-based products, supporting innovation and shelf-life extension across global supply chains.

USA Growing Food Encapsulation Market (2025)
The United States remains the largest and most influential market for food encapsulation technologies in 2025, driven by advanced R&D capabilities, strong functional food consumption, and rapid adoption of microencapsulation and nano-delivery systems across food, beverage, and nutraceutical sectors. The U.S. Food Encapsulation Market accounted for an estimated USD 3.48–3.72 billion in 2025, representing nearly 31–33% of the global market value. Growth is primarily propelled by increasing consumer demand for clean-label, fortified, and health-enhancing food products, alongside rising interest in personalized nutrition and nutraceutical supplementation.
Functional ingredients play a significant role in shaping the U.S. market landscape. Approximately 40% of encapsulation demand in the country is linked to nutrient stabilization, supporting premium formulations containing omega-3 oils, probiotics, carotenoids, vitamins, and bioactive minerals. The U.S. has one of the largest probiotic consumer bases globally, fueling the adoption of encapsulation technologies that improve survival during processing and digestive transit. Furthermore, flavor masking and controlled release applications account for nearly 25% of U.S. market usage in 2025, driven by the rapid growth of plant-based foods, energy beverages, CBD-infused products, and high-protein snacks where bitterness or off-notes require suppression.
The U.S. food and nutraceutical manufacturing ecosystem also benefits from strong innovation by leading companies such as Cargill, Balchem, IFF, Sensient Technologies, and Ingredion, which continue to invest in advanced encapsulation technologies including liposomal delivery, spray chilling, cyclodextrin inclusion complexes, and multi-layered coatings for targeted functionality. The country witnessed a 9–10% increase in industrial-scale encapsulation investments in 2025, supported by demand from dairy, bakery, meal-replacement beverages, dietary supplements, and functional confectionery sectors.
Additionally, the regulatory environment—shaped by the FDA, USDA, and GRAS frameworks—supports the adoption of safe, high-performance encapsulation materials such as polysaccharides, lipids, proteins, and bio-derived polymers. Growing consumer preference for healthier, nutrient-dense foods has also encouraged manufacturers to incorporate encapsulated vitamins, omega oils, antioxidants, polyphenols, and probiotics into mainstream products, contributing to a projected CAGR of 10–11% in the U.S. through 2035.

Global Distribution of Food Encapsulation Manufacturers (2025)
The global distribution of Food Encapsulation manufacturers in 2025 reflects a highly diversified but capability-concentrated ecosystem, led by North America and Europe, while Asia-Pacific continues to rapidly scale up production and R&D specialization. Manufacturing footprint, technological sophistication, and ingredient innovation vary significantly across regions, with production hubs emerging around strong food-processing clusters and nutraceutical markets.
North America accounted for the largest share—about 34% of global Food Encapsulation manufacturing capacity in 2025. The United States serves as the primary hub due to advanced processing technologies, high adoption of controlled-release systems, and strong presence of industry leaders such as Cargill, Balchem, Sensient Technologies, IFF, and Ingredion. The region invests heavily in microencapsulation, liposomal delivery, spray drying, and nano-structured coating technologies, supporting both food and nutraceutical innovation.
Europe represented approximately 32% of global manufacturer distribution, with key production concentrated in the Netherlands, Germany, Ireland, France, and the UK. Companies such as FrieslandCampina Kievit, Royal DSM, Symrise AG, Kerry Group, and Lycored anchor Europe’s footprint. The region is known for its strong regulatory standards, leading to high adoption of clean-label capsules, natural polymers, and bio-derived encapsulation materials.
The Asia-Pacific region held around 26% of global manufacturer presence, reinforced by rising demand for fortified foods, growing nutraceutical markets, and expanding R&D operations in China, India, Japan, and South Korea. APAC production capacity is increasing at 11–13% annually, with China emerging as a major producer of encapsulated vitamins, botanical actives, and functional ingredient blends. India has become a significant hub for probiotic and herbal extract microencapsulation, driven by functional beverage and dietary supplement growth.
Latin America and the Middle East & Africa collectively accounted for 8% of global distribution, with manufacturing activity centered in Brazil, Mexico, and the UAE. These regions are increasingly adopting encapsulation technologies for dairy fortification, confectionery stabilization, and shelf-life extension, although most high-value actives are still imported from the U.S. and Europe.

High-End & Specialty Food Encapsulation Manufacturers (2025)
High-end and specialty Food Encapsulation manufacturers represent the technologically advanced segment of the market, supplying precision delivery systems for nutrients, probiotics, flavors, and sensitive bioactives. These companies play a critical role in applications requiring enhanced stability, targeted release, nano-scale protection, and high bioavailability—particularly for premium functional foods, nutraceuticals, medical nutrition, and performance beverages. In 2025, specialty manufacturers contributed an estimated 18–22% of global encapsulation revenues, valued at roughly USD 2.1–2.4 billion, reflecting increased demand for clinical-grade ingredient performance and specialized delivery systems.
Balchem Corporation (USA) leads the specialty category with expertise in microencapsulated choline, amino acids, and mineral systems used in infant nutrition, sports nutrition, and dietary supplements. The company expanded its capacity in 2025 by 14%, driven by rising demand for encapsulated nutrient systems with thermal stability.
Lycored (Israel) is another high-end manufacturer known for its advanced beadlet technology for carotenoids, lycopene, and lutein—solutions engineered for oxidative protection and controlled release. Lycored reported a 12% increase in global demand for encapsulated natural colorants and antioxidants in 2025.
Royal DSM (Netherlands) specializes in lipid-encapsulated omega-3 fatty acids and fat-soluble vitamins, achieving double-digit growth of around 11% in its Encapsulation segment in 2025. DSM’s technology enhances bioavailability and stability in fortified dairy, bakery, and beverage applications.
Kerry Group (Ireland) and FrieslandCampina Kievit (Netherlands) remain leading innovators in spray-dried encapsulates, especially for flavors, creamers, and heat-sensitive actives. Kerry expanded its encapsulation output by 9% in 2025, while FrieslandCampina saw strong demand in APAC and North America for its premium flavor systems.
Emerging specialty players in the Asia-Pacific region, including advanced nutraceutical encapsulators in Japan, South Korea, and India, recorded growth rates of 13–15%, reflecting increasing regional demand for probiotic microencapsulation and botanical protection systems.
